Introduction: There are 5 basic elements in the novel Animal Farm. They are: Exposition, Rising Action, Climax, Falling Action and Resolution. This paper will describe how the author uses each element to smoothly transition through the story. Exposition: Orwell begins by depicting the scene in the farmhouse in which he introduces all of the characters. The narrator gives the reader a taste of each animal’s personality by describing the way each enters the barn. The …
